Subject: Change of responsibilities — Billwright deploys

Hello plugin authors,

Starting next sprint, blue-green deploys for the Billwright billing worker move to a new owner. Cutover windows stay the same (Tuesdays and Thursdays), and the plugin compatibility checks will still run against the green environment before traffic shifts. Please route deploy-window questions and plugin certification requests to the new owner rather than the old alias. The new responsible party is named below.

approver of yajef-fajef = Oliwyn Silion Kasok Kasox

Alert: SQL lint gate failed (Driftstone toolkit)

Your plugin submitted SQL files that violate one or more mandatory lint rules. Common causes: unqualified table references, missing statement terminators, or disallowed dynamic SQL. The gate blocks publication until all errors clear; warnings are advisory. Re-run the linter locally with the strict flag before resubmitting. Rule definitions, severity levels, and suppression syntax for approved exceptions are listed on the rules reference page.

wiki page, tahaf-tajog: https://jira.ordindyn.corp/pipeline

**Visitor Policy — First-Aid Room**

The first-aid room at Thornfield Court (ground floor, beside the post room) is open to all visitors and new starters in an emergency. Do not wait for an escort if someone is injured; go directly and pull the assistance cord inside. Supplies are restocked weekly by the facilities team. Outside staffed hours the door is kept locked, and entry requires the code below.

turnstile pass: bdg-QZV-3